Indian Hill
Short Film

    "Indian Hill" is a rights of passage story about what it takes to no longer be one of the "little kids" in one suburban neighborhood. Based on the true experiences of the author growing up in suburban Connecticut in the 70s.

Survivor's Rites
Feature Film

Survivor's Rites is a character driven social drama that centers around three young adults coming to terms with the murder of their mother and the pending execution of the man who killed her; their own step father.

The Father's Child
Feature Film

The Father's Child is a religious fable that follows a special young man with the ability to touch people and make them see heaven as he travels cross country in order to fulfill a destiny he's not even sure of.
